The Selected Letters of John Kenneth Galbraith offers a fascinating glimpse into the mind of one of the 20th century's most influential economists. Through a carefully curated selection of letters, readers are privy to Galbraith's conversations with world leaders, intellectuals, and everyday people. The correspondence reveals his deep commitment to social justice, economic equality, and international cooperation. Galbraith's sharp wit and elegant prose shine through every page, making this collection a delightful read for both scholars and casual readers alike. While the book provides a valuable historical record, it also offers timeless insights into the challenges and opportunities of modern society.
